Founded with the mission to revolutionize the way data center services are sourced, Upstack provides a modern platform that empowers IT and data center professionals with smart tools and actionable business intelligence. The company's vision is to enhance and accelerate IT infrastructure through end-to-end expertise and support. Upstack offers a range of services focused on sourcing customized technology solutions, leveraging a combination of leading technology experts and efficient software products to help businesses make intelligent decisions.

Upstack has attracted notable investors and industry experts, contributing to its rapid growth and credibility in the market. Key achievements include the development of a robust platform that integrates actionable insights and practical tools, making it a go-to resource for IT professionals. The overall impact of Upstack is seen in its ability to streamline the decision-making process for data center services, ultimately driving digital transformation for its clients.

Upstack - Quick Facts

When was Upstack founded?

Upstack was founded in 2016.

Where is Upstack's headquarters located?

Upstack's headquarters is located in New York City, NY, US.

When was Upstack's last funding round?

Upstack's most recent funding round was for $100M (USD) in November 2021.

How much has Upstack raised to-date?

As of Nov 2, 2021, Upstack has raised a total of $186.8M (USD).

How many employees does Upstack have?

Upstack has 375 employees as of Feb 4, 2024.
